One of the most well-known examples of animal intelligence is the use of tools. Some species of primates, such as chimpanzees, are notorious for their ability to use sticks to extract termites from their nests or rocks to crack open nuts. This tool use is not instinctive but learned, suggesting a level of foresight and planning. Similarly, crows have been observed using twigs to create tools that allow them to extract food from difficult-to-reach places. These behaviors showcase an impressive understanding of cause and effect, as well as the ability to plan and manipulate the environment to meet their needs.
In the oceans, dolphins are another example of intelligent problem-solvers. Dolphins are known to work cooperatively when hunting, using techniques that involve teamwork and communication. For instance, dolphins will herd fish into a tight group, creating an easy target for feeding. In addition to hunting techniques, dolphins are capable of solving problems in captivity as well. They can navigate mazes, recognize themselves in mirrors (a sign of self-awareness), and even understand complex human commands. Their ability to work together and solve challenges in both natural and controlled environments highlights their advanced cognitive capabilities.
Elephants, on the other hand, are another example of animals that exhibit remarkable intelligence. Known for their excellent memory, elephants can remember locations, other animals, and humans over long periods of time. This ability to recall information is crucial for survival, as it helps them navigate vast landscapes and avoid dangers. Additionally, elephants display empathy, a trait often associated with human intelligence. They have been observed mourning the loss of loved ones, helping injured companions, and even showing kindness toward other species. These complex emotional and cognitive behaviors indicate that elephants possess a deep understanding of their surroundings and relationships.
Another fascinating example of animal intelligence is the octopus. Octopuses are renowned for their problem-solving skills, particularly their ability to escape from enclosures. In laboratory settings, octopuses have been observed solving complex puzzles, opening jars to retrieve food, and navigating mazes. Their unique ability to manipulate their environment and adapt to different situations demonstrates a high level of intelligence for an invertebrate. The octopus’s advanced nervous system and highly developed brain allow them to engage in these complex behaviors, which are quite rare among marine species.
